A Professional Certificate in Climate Resilient Infrastructure Planning and Management is increasingly significant given the UK's vulnerability to climate change. The UK Climate Change Risk Assessment (CCRA) highlights escalating risks, with infrastructure particularly at risk. The Office for National Statistics reports that flood damage alone costs the UK billions annually. This necessitates professionals skilled in designing, building, and managing infrastructure capable of withstanding extreme weather events and adapting to long-term climate shifts. The certificate equips individuals with the crucial knowledge and skills to address these challenges, meeting the growing industry demand for expertise in sustainable and climate-resilient infrastructure development.

Climate Change Impact Infrastructure Affected
Increased Flooding Transportation, Utilities
Heatwaves Energy grids, Buildings
Stronger Storms Coastal defenses, Telecommunications
